Mars Buys Wrigley, With Assist From Buffett

Proposed purchase could push Hershey into merger to compete

By Jim O'Neill,  Newser User

Posted Apr 28, 2008 8:05 AM CDT

(Newser) – M&Ms-maker Mars, backed by Warren Buffett, has made a deal to buy Wm. Wrigley Jr. Co. for about $23 billion, reports the New York Times. The acquisition is likely to force other candy makers like Hershey and Cadbury Schweppes into mergers to maintain market...   Read full story »
